How do I know if a tree needs to be removed?

Several signs indicate a tree may need removal: dead or dying branches throughout the canopy, visible decay or hollow areas in the trunk, significant lean that’s getting worse, or root damage from construction. Trees that consistently drop large branches or show signs of disease that can’t be treated also pose safety risks. Our arborists can assess your trees and explain whether removal is necessary or if other treatments might save them. We don’t recommend removal unless it’s truly needed—healthy trees add value to your property.

Most mature trees benefit from professional pruning every 3-5 years, but it depends on the species, age, and condition of your trees. Young trees may need more frequent attention to develop proper structure. Trees near power lines, buildings, or walkways might need annual attention for safety. Dead or damaged branches should be removed promptly regardless of timing. Our arborists can evaluate your specific trees and recommend a maintenance schedule that keeps them healthy and safe while fitting your budget.
